What does PUNB0RRBTGB mean?
PUNB0RRBTGB
PUNB — Bank code. Identifies Tripura Gramin Bank. All branches of Tripura Gramin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
RRBTGB —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the Tripura Gramin Bank IMPS branch within Tripura Gramin Bank.
